Output 07430a15dd6690db5e20680857fb9fe42ae6c0fbae3fd843fad90dc50fe8c98b:12

value
21390680
script pubkey
OP_0 OP_PUSHBYTES_20 379c2156f6132e52a8fb44a591b84cc420ba626e
address
bc1qx7wzz4hkzvh9928mgjjerwzvcsst5cnwmaekrh
transaction
07430a15dd6690db5e20680857fb9fe42ae6c0fbae3fd843fad90dc50fe8c98b